Is a trade with Baltimore possible now?

Featured Replies

Now that Vlad has signed with the Angels, that might create a trade opportunity with the Orioles. Baltimore might be interested in Magglio. Over a month ago, I read about a Magglio for Jay Gibbons rumor. That's not enough. However, Magglio for Gibbons and 2b Brian Roberts would make me interested.

 

Gibbons would provide a good young left handed hitter to replace Magglio. Roberts with his speed could lead off and play second base. I think the Sox would save over 10 million in salary which they could invest in pitching. If Willie Harris turns out to be a stud, he could split time with Roberts at second and play some centerfield.

 

I think Ponson is no longer an option for the Sox. There is no way they would outbid Baltimore. Maddux would be a great PR move for the Sox and would put butts in seats but he probably won't come to the AL. For starting pitching, the Sox may be better off using the money to make a trade and pay part of our player's salary. For example, Konerko to the Dodgers for Perez and prospect with the Sox paying part of the difference in salary. Or, they could plan on adding a pitcher via a trade midseason

 

There are a number of good relief pitchers available. I think for the right price Urbina would be a really nice addition. Urbina, Marte, Koch, Pollite, Wunch, Wright could be an outstanding pen.

 

I like the Red Sox trade rumor better for next year. Gibbons and Roberts may be better in the long run if the Sox because all of the Red Sox players will be free agents. It wouldn't hurt to give Baltimore a call and see how interested they might be. There may be an opportunity for a bidding war.
